Xltools addin for ms excel 2016, 20, 2010, and 2017 provides a set of tools for data manipulation, automation, and version control. If you dont see the power query tab in excel 2010 or 20 you can download it here. Nov 16, 2015 once the editor resquest is loaded, do a left click on table into the third column. This workbook provides the code samples and macros that create power query queries and given an input m formula, load the tranformed data into. This example shows how to login, retrieve a table, and paste it into excel. For more information, and to see these steps in action, take a look at getting started.
Initially, it will display your default internet explorer home page. Apr 29, 2011 briefly, an excel web query is a great way to automate the mundane task of going to a web page and copying the data into an excel sheet. Basically you tell excel where to look web page and what to copy tables of data and excel will automatically import the data into a worksheet for you. In this article i will explain how to retrieve data from a website using a query table and vba previously in the article excel getting data from the web ive explained how you can use query tables to import data from the web into an excel worksheet. Use power query s query editor to import data from a local excel file that contains product information, and from an odata feed that contains product order information. In this article it is assumed readers are familiar with using query tables. S i am using excel 2016 64bit version on windows 10. It will find any tables on the web page and let you select the ones containing data you want to put into your. Microsoft download manager is free and available for download now. How to pullextract data from a website into excel automatically. It will find any tables on the web page and let you select the. To use power query, just click the data tab in excel 2016 or newer, called get and transform data. What do i need to do to make excel access a web query via. For each web query, you set up an excel spreadsheet that automatically refreshes every week.
How to extract data from multiple webpages with power query. Power pivot and power query for excel 2016 power bi. Power query in excel 2016 for windows data tab of ribbon get and transform. Sep 14, 2006 an excel web query allows you to bring data from a web site into an excel worksheet. How to make web queries in data lists in excel 2016 dummies. By automating internet explorer and the login process, you can get to that data.
This provides a clean alternative to excels web browser. If you dont see the get data button, click new query from database from access. If you want to import data you best look at excels web connection wizard, this is ie based but it will happily download any tables etc you want. Microsoft power query for excel is an excel addin that enhances the selfservice business intelligence experience in excel by simplifying data. Follow the steps in the navigator dialog to connect to the table or query of your choice. Take your skills to the next level with tables, formulas, formatting and more. Briefly, an excel web query is a great way to automate the mundane task of going to a web page and copying the data into an excel sheet. Office use vba to automate power query in excel 2016. Figure 1 returning external data to excel click the properties button to display the e xternal data range properties dialog when you first make a query. Another method is to open the power query editor without selecting a specific query.
It was previously known as power query and is still a free download for excel 20 2010. How to pull exchange rates from a web page into excel or. The following table shows basic and advanced features available by version. This makes it challenging to import data from some web pages, and frustrates users. In the import data dialog box, browse for or type a file url to import or link to a file. Pull data into microsoft excel with web queries techrepublic.
In this scenario its connecting to the reserve bank of australia exchange rates web page. Build repeatable processes to filter, clean, aggregate, and transform your data. The complete guide to installing power query excel campus. When hovering over a query dont click, just hover, excel displays the query summary. The new query button allows you to connect to multiple data sources to retrieve, edit and manipulate data. Click the data tab, then get data from database from microsoft access database. Download latest version of microsoft excel 2016 for windows. Excel then opens the new web query dialog box containing the home page for your computers default web browser internet explorer 10 in most cases. Excel 2016 now includes power query which used to be an add in technology in 2010 and 20. To select the web page containing the data you want to import into. Realtime excel get live stock prices, currency rates and more includes working spreadsheets for this tip and many other examples of getting live information into excel. This 3 minute video shows how easy it is to link to web page data with excel. Use power querys query editor to import data from a local excel file that contains product information, and from an odata feed that contains product order information.
Change default browser for excel web query i think that i may have found what controls this behaviour. Install and activate an excel power query addin dummies. Its a sad indictment of microsoft office that the best place to. If that doesnt work, just enter a search term for now. Microsoft office word is a program that allows you to create documents. Excel can grab that data and put it into cells for the worksheet. If you dont see the new query button, click data from web.
If youre using excel 201020, download the microsoft power query addin to get started. Heres another method of getting stock prices into excel. You must have microsoft excel 2007 or later to use this functionality. In power query editor, rightclick on the query and select create function. I want the enddate value in the url to be taken from cell a2. Power query records all of your steps, and they will be repeated whenever you refresh your data. Using power query for extracting nontabular data from web.
Within a couple of minutes you can build a query that will pull data from a webpage and transform it into the desired format. Some of the other board members might show you how you could run a sql query or something if you are. In the excel worksheet, open the data ribbon and click on the from web command. When you open each report after the weekly refresh, the reports are ready for delivery. Choose from a wide range of data connectors to import the data you need.
For more information about creating web queries, see excel web query secrets revealed. We will be using the excels from web command in the data ribbon to collect data from the web. If you want to get data into excel from a website that requires a login, you may have already been frustrated that web queries dont work so well. This video show how to use the new tool to record a macro to get data from a website. For more information about excel web queries from microsoft. Web queries offer a handy way to import data from selected tables into a worksheetbut excel isnt as accommodating as it should be, especially when it comes to parameters. Apr 25, 2016 another way to run queries is to use microsoft power query also known in excel 2016 and up as get and transform. Function replicates mcode used in the initial query but adds an option to call itself with a parameter url. You can download excel power query here from microsoft. Scrape data from multiple web pages with power query using a custom.
When you first make your web query, there are settings available to you in the returning external data to excel dialog see figure 1. Jun 08, 2019 when hovering over a query dont click, just hover, excel displays the query summary. In excel 2016 we have included macro recording and object model support. Get data from web not showing table microsoft power. Previously in the article excel getting data from the web ive explained how you can use query tables to import data from the web into an excel worksheet.
How to create a microsoft query in excel excel query. This browser worked well for many years, but, recently, script errors began appearing on some pages. Excel vba, retrieving data from a website using a query table. Import data from external data sources power query excel. Another way to run queries is to use microsoft power query also known in excel 2016 and up as get and transform. If you have excel 2016 then power query is already builtin and located on the data tab of the ribbon. Doubleclick the excel web query file and this should. In 2017, excel was upadated with a patch that replaced the old web query wizard with a more genral query tool. Atras directx enduser runtime web installer next directx enduser runtime web installer. Aug 29, 2017 in 2017, excel was upadated with a patch that replaced the old web query wizard with a more genral query tool. So is there a way to change this code from using internet explorer and use excel web query browser so that it can auto log in and i just have to refresh the external connection from web which is already added into my excel sheet.
In excel 2016, power query isnt an addin its a native feature of excel. The download page for power query lists which version of excel are. The addin provided by microsoft does require knowledge of the sql language, rather allowing you to click your way through the data you want to tranform. On the data tab, click new query from other sources from web. With the excel web query tool, as long as the data that you want to grab or analyze is stored in something that looks like a table that is, in something that uses rows and columns to organize the information you can grab the information and place it into an excel workbook. Apr 16, 2019 download the version of the power query addin that matches the architecture x86 or x64 of your office installation. Once the editor resquest is loaded, do a left click on table into the third column. In excel 2016 onward and office 365 power query is integrated and is included in the data tab, which means you dont need to download or install it. I have an excel 2016 workbook with a dozen spreadsheets each with a web query to a different rest api at the same account.
With office, you have 365 days ahead of you filled with. Refresh web data into excel every minute techtv articles. An excel web query allows you to bring data from a web site into an excel worksheet. With a web query, you can set up a program that will automatically gather uptothe second refreshed data from the web every time you open the spreadsheet. Download microsoft power query for excel from official microsoft. There are many places on the web which supply exchange rate information in a computer readable format. How to install power query in excel 2010 or 20 for windows. Aug 15, 2015 previously in the article excel getting data from the web ive explained how you can use query tables to import data from the web into an excel worksheet. In the default programs that i mentioned earlier, in the section set associations, there is an entry for web query and the extension is. Excel web query to login into a website stack overflow. I want the startdate value in the url to be taken from cell a1.
Excel has a builtin web browser that can be used to view web pages and import selected web data. Combine data from multiple data sources power query excel. To start, use data import external data new web query. Download the version of the power query addin that matches the architecture x86 or x64 of your office installation. You perform transformation and aggregation steps, and combine data from both sources to produce a total sales per product and year report. Lets say similar to the article excel getting data from the web we want to get the usd to cad currency exchange. Play around with the web query options and properties by rightclicking within the. See different ways of using web queries in microsoft office excel 2003 as a starting point. The most effective way to do this in power query is to create function from existing query. Rather than change the web query each time, i would prefer the web query to read cell values in order to complete the url. Download microsoft power query for excel from official. Excel web queries hacking them to automate your work. After creating a table for the symbols that you want, you can publish the sheet as a web page via file.